A successful Scrum Master ‘s key responsibilities include creating successful scrum teams with strong skills in self-organization and cross-functionality and a drive for continuous improvement. Helping & supporting Product Owners in visualizing progress, creating a transparent Product Backlog, and maximizing the value of the product. Helping organizations in making & successfully adopting Scrum by supporting management in changing processes, procedures, culture, and behavior.
Agile Methodologies: Need to be an expert in scrum so that you can coach the scrum team. You need to take the continuous improvement principles Scrum applies and embrace them at a very personal level. Also, it is important to know other frameworks under Agile. Get trained in Scrum & appear Professional Scrum Master (PSM-I, II, III) or a Certified Scrum Master (CSM) certificate. To read more on different certifications Click Here.
Software Project Management: Understand how projects are handled in SDLC methodology as it will help you in understanding why scrum is needed in the current world. It’s key to understand the differences between a “Product” and “Project” & why Scrum works and what problem it solves. Few areas to consider Project Management, Business Analysis, Development, Quality Assurance, etc.
Scrum Requirements Analysis: Traditional project management restricts requirement change but as a scrum master you need to understand what scrum recommends and change the mindset of the team to accept this change. A good Scrum Master can help their teamwork in better collaboration with their stakeholders to understand the problems they want to be solved and deliver quickly to solve the most important problems. This gives delivery teams the flexibility to change as the needs of the customer change.
Technical Knowledge: Even though technical knowledge is not critical to be a successful scrum master but having good technical knowledge will definitely help a scrum master to be successful. It helps to understand the impediments when working with product development teams. Knowledge of Agile tools like Xray, JIRA, etc definitely helps in managing the team effectively.
Additional Skills: Good influencer, strong network within the organization, excellent soft skills, and high emotional intelligence are necessary to be a good Scrum Master.
A great Scrum Master…
Initial questions to be considered by a scrum master are:
As a daily preparation a Scrum Master could consider questions like:
How is my Product Owner doing?
How is the Scrum Team doing?
How are our engineering practices doing?
How is my organization doing?
Books to consider to grow in scrum master role
Agile-Lean Practitioner
Teaching & Mentoring
Coaching
Facilitating
Technical Mastery
Business Mastery
Transformational Mastery
Being a Scrum Master is a challenging, but rewarding role. Experience in this role is the key to success. Sometimes doing “nothing” is a perfect activity for a Scrum Master! The biggest pitfall for a Scrum Master is being too busy and not noticing what is really going on. It takes years of experience and training to be a good scrum master.
A well-maintained product backlog is crucial for successful product development. It serves as a single…
Incremental value to the customer refers to the gradual delivery of small, functional parts of…
A Product Market refers to the group of potential customers who might be interested in…
The Professional Agile Leadership - Evidence-Based Management (PAL-EBM) certification offered by Scrum.org is designed for…
The Professional Agile Leadership (PAL I) certification, offered by Scrum.org, is designed to equip leaders…
Choosing the right Scrum Master Certification depends on your current experience and career goals. If…